Limnocyon medius
Taxonomy
Limnocyon medius was named by Wortman (1902).
It was recombined as Thinocyon medius by Matthew (1909), Thorpe (1923), Denison (1938), Gazin (1976), Polly (1996), Gunnell (1998).
